Teutopolis fell victim to Flora and their airtight pitching crew on Tuesday. They fell just short of the Wolves by a score of 2-0. Having soared to a lofty 12 runs in the game before, the Wooden Shoes' shutout was a dramatic turnaround.
Alyssa Tipton sp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ered only one earned (and one unearned) run on three hits and racked up 12 Ks. She has been consistent recently: she hasn't given up more than one earned run in four consecutive appearances.
Teutopolis' defeat ended a three-game streak of away wins and brought them to 6-5. As for Flora, their victory bumped their record up to 3-5.
Both squads are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Teutopolis will take on Windsor/Stewardson-Strasburg at 4:30 p.m. on Thursday. As for Flora, they will be playing in front of their home fans against Farina South Central at 4:30 p.m. on Wednesday. The Wolves' pitchers better be ready for this one: the Cougars have averaged an impressive 8.8 runs per game this season.
